NAF Deploys Helicopter, ISR Aircraft to Plateau
The Nigerian Air Force (NAF) has today, 25 June 2018, deployed an Mi-35P combat helicopter and an Intelligence Surveillance and Reconnaissance (ISR) aircraft to Plateau State in support of efforts aimed at quelling the crisis that recently erupted in the State and restoring normalcy. The deployment of the ISR aircraft is expected to enhance intelligence gathering while the combat helicopter would conduct armed reconnaissance and other combat air support operations in close coordination with surface forces deployed to the State. Meanwhile, other NAF air assets are available at nearby alternate airfields to hasten the process of restoring normalcy in the State, as might be necessary.

DIG, Police Helicopters, APCs Deployed to Plateau State

The Inspector General of Police, IGP Ibrahim K. Idris, NPM mni, concerned with the recent killings of innocent people in Barkin-Ladi (Gashishi), Riyom, Jos South LGAs and other flash points in the State with the attendant disturbance of public peace, clashes and mayhem that engulfed the affected areas in Plateau State on the 23rd and 24th of June, 2018 which resulted in the loss of several innocent lives, burning of houses and vehicles, and destruction of properties, has promptly deployed since on 24th June, 2018 the Police Special Intervention Force to Plateau State to Restore Lasting Peace in Barkin-Ladi, Riyom, Jos South LGA and other flash points in the State.

2. The intervention is to put an end to the crisis, the Deputy Inspector General of Police; Department of Operations is being relocated on the directive of the IGP to Jos, Plateau State to coordinate and supervise the operations on the ground.

3. Two (2) Police Aerial surveillance Helicopters, Five (5) Armored Personnel Carriers (APCs), Three (3) Police Mobile Force Units (PMF), Two (2) Counter Terrorism Cells (CTU ) and Police Intelligence Unit and conventional Police personnel from other States have been deployed to the affected areas in Plateau State. The Police Aerial surveillance Helicopters and other components of the intervention Force are already in the State. Their arrival in the State has restored peace and prevent further attacks in the affected areas.

4. The IGP has directed the Commissioner of Police in charge IGP monitoring Unit to lead the Police Special investigation Team to the affected areas and other flash points in Plateau State. The investigation Team comprises the Intelligence Response Team ( IRT), the Special Tactical Squad (STS) and the Technical Platforms. The team is to carryout a thorough and discreet investigation into the killings and promptly apprehend those responsible..

5. The Police Special Intervention Force, also includes personnel of Force Criminal Intelligence and Investigation Department (FCIID) , detachment of Police Explosive Ordinance Department (EOD), Police K9 (Sniffer Dogs Section), Conventional Policemen, Special Anti Robbery Squads. The team that have started arriving are already working in synergy with the Plateau State Police Command to ensure that the peace and normalcy restored are sustained in the affected areas and other flash points in Plateau State.

6. To achieve success in this operation, the team will be proactive and strict in the enforcement of its mandates, Police standard operations procedures and rule of engagement will be fully adhered to.

7. The Police Special Intervention Force will ensure the full enforcement of the curfew imposed on the affected areas by the Plateau State Government. The personnel of the Police special Intervention Force will carry out twenty four (24) hours surveillance and patrol, stop and search of vehicles, and suspected locations and hideouts of the assailants . The Team will also engage in continuous raids of identified criminal hideouts and black spots, with a view to arrest promptly those responsible for the killings and nip in the bud and prevent any further attack, attempt to attack or cause any form of violence that can lead to killings and other criminalities in the affected areas.

8. The deployment of the personnel of the Police Special Intervention Force will equally cover communities, towns, villages, vulnerable settlements, Government and private infrastructures and facilities in all the affected areas and other flash points in the State.

Police Confirm 84 Killed in Plateau

Sequel to the attack in Gashish District of Barkin Ladi LGA yesterday 23/06/2018 , the Commissioner of Police Plateau State Command, Jos CP Undie Adie after deploying more personnel to the District sent a search and rescue team from the Command headquarters today for on the spot assessment .

The team headed by ACP Edeh John of the Department of Operations had also the DPO of Barkin Ladi Division and a Unit Commander from Mopol 38.

After a careful search of the villages attacked in the District the following were discovered
1. Eighty six (86) persons all together were killed
2. Six people injured
3. Fifty (50) house burnt
4. Fifteen (15) motorcycles burnt down
5. Two (2) motor vehicles burnt down
The team also carried out a detailed deployment.

Corpses were released to the families for burial.

The Command earlier in the day confirmed only eleven (11) people dead as the result of the attack due to the information at its disposal then before the arrival of the search and rescue team from Barkin Ladi LGA.

Plateau Killings: Saraki Calls for Quick Response Team

President of the Senate, Dr. Abubakar Bukola Saraki has advised President Muhammadu Buhari to direct his security chiefs to immediately produce quick response measures aimed at tackling the spate of killings in the country.

Saraki, while responding to the killings in Barkin Ladi Local Government Area in which scores of people were murdered in attacks by unknown assailants on some villages, said it is important for Nigerians to start having the assurances that the government is decisively responding to the current threat to lives and properties in parts of the country.

“I am very sad to hear the news of the incident in Plateau State. This is very depressing and giving the impression that the country is not safe. The problem of Boko Haram in the North-east is well known to everybody but this killing by unknown band of assailants in Benue, Taraba, Plateau and Kaduna States is now giving another dimension to the crisis. Coming at the time we are getting ready for elections, we need to respond fast.

“If the plan is to develop some long term measures, we also request that the President should mandate the security chiefs to put forward an immediate short term and quick response measure which will restore confidence in the system and demonstrate to the criminals behind this killings the capacity of government to tackle the issue.

“We have to immediately device a plan through which the criminals behind the killings and their sponsors can be nabbed and made to face the wrath of the law. We have to also develop plans to mop up illegal fire arms in the hands of dangerous elements while also stopping the influx of these arms into the country”, he stated.

The Senate President however commiserated with the people of Barkin Ladi Local Governement Area and the Government of Plateau State over the weekend attack on some of the communities. He prayed for the repose of the deceased and for Almighty God to grant the injured swift recovery.

Dogara Condemns Attack On Plateau Mourners, Calls For Apprehension Of Culprits

Speaker of the House of Representatives, Hon Yakubu Dogara, has condemned the killing of about 200 people in the Church of Christ In Nations (COCIN) Regional Church Council (RCC) Rop in Barikin Ladi Local Government Area, Plateau State reportedly by suspected armed herdsmen.
Hon Dogara said it was reprehensible that people who gathered to bury their dead would be gruesomely murdered in that manner.
“Our security agencies must rise up to the task of securing the lives of citizens of this country. The attack reportedly lasted from 1:00 p.m. noon of Friday, and lasted till about 8:00 p.m. on Saturday. Where was the Police and other security agencies that they failed to respond to stop the killings?” he queried.
“This further strengthens my constant call for an overhaul of the entire security apparatus of this country. It just isn’t working,” he stated.

He said that rising level of violence and gruesome killings of innocent and hapless citizens poses serious threat to Nigeria’s democracy and must be stopped.
